What is Leanides Lab Station?

The Leanides lab station was initially created to facilitate the transfer of virtual GNS3 lab configurations to actual Cisco devices. Over time, it has transformed into a comprehensive lab system capable of storing all your Cisco lab configurations, ensuring they are easily accessible for deployment and storage. This setup allows for the swift and straightforward transfer of configuration text files to Cisco devices, potentially revolutionizing how individuals prepare these devices for laboratory settings. Through my experiences conducting various Cisco Labs and configuring numerous Cisco devices in professional environments, I recognized a pressing need for a tool that could expedite the deployment of network configurations to Cisco hardware. As I continued to explore this necessity, I envisioned a versatile tool designed to cater to users at every level of Cisco education. Ultimately, the ambition was to develop a solution that was both highly functional and user-friendly, making it accessible to a wider audience.

What is Cisco IOx?

The Cisco IOx application framework combines the strengths of Cisco IOS with the Linux operating system to establish a secure networking framework. By leveraging Cisco IOS software, users can deploy IoT applications that guarantee secure connections while delivering reliable services for efficient integration with IoT sensors and cloud solutions. Executing applications directly at the data generation point enhances the speed of insights, supports informed decision-making, and encourages effective actions. Cisco IOx empowers IoT developers by offering a Linux-based environment that allows them to utilize their preferred programming languages, frameworks, and open-source tools. This platform is designed to handle large volumes of data while supporting real-time closed-loop control systems. Moreover, Cisco IOx supports consistent management and hosting across a variety of network infrastructure products, including routers, switches, and computing modules, which ensures smooth operation. The adaptability of this platform further solidifies its importance for developers looking to drive innovation within the IoT sector. As IoT technologies continue to evolve, Cisco IOx stands as a vital resource for fostering advancements in connectivity and data processing.
